Kabul: armed Taliban men patrol streets on roller skates

Members of the Taliban were seen gliding through Kabul’s streets wearing roller skates. The armed men catapulted and launched each other onto a busy street while some held onto the armoured trucks. 

Reports say the men who patrolled the streets on skates were part of the public security force, which answers to the Ministry of Interior.

The “amazing balance and body strength,” of the skating men was appreciated by a fellow member of the security forces. “It might be common in the world elsewhere, but for us, it was rare to see on the roads of Kabul,” a member told the Telegraph.

The authenticity of the unusual video was confirmed by Khalid Zadran, the spokesperson of Kabul’s police wings. 

Social media users also reacted to the video. “They’re just spinning their wheels,” a user commented on the viral video.
